Another significant application involves Search and rescue. Emergency squads can send off drones swiftly to find missing individuals, examine disaster zones, and recognize hazards after floods, fires, earthquakes, or storms. Thermal imaging electronic cameras can also help operators discover persons in low-visibility situations, as demonstrated with C-UAS Systems created by businesses like Echodyne. In agriculture, drones are more frequently deployed in Precision farming and Crop monitoring. Fitted with high-resolution or multispectral cameras, they can recognize changes in plant condition, irrigation troubles, pest activity, and regions calling for nutrients. Farmers can utilize this information to make additional precise decisions while decreasing unnecessary application of water and agricultural chemicals. Drone systems are additionally important in construction and design. They can capture aerial views of building locations, track initiative development, inspect land, and check structures such as bridges, towers, and rooftops. Such capabilities help specialists improve security while collecting exact information without putting personnel in dangerous situations. Drone systems have actually developed from specialized aerospace innovation into versatile tools used across sectors. These Unmanned aerial vehicles (UAVs) merge cams, sensing units, GPS, and automated flight controls to gather details and carry out jobs from the air. One of their crucial uses is Aerial surveillance, where drones can check large locations swiftly and effectively. Enterprises, governments, and emergency solutions use them to evaluate infrastructure, observe hard-to-access areas, and aid calamity response. In comparison to standard aircraft or ground-based crews, drone innovation can typically cut costs, improve reach, and supply real-time data.
